High Fructose Corn Syrup, often abbreviated as HFCS, represents the pinnacle of modern dessert-inspired cannabis breeding. This contemporary hybrid emerges from the growing trend of connoisseur cultivars that expertly blend the sugary, fruit-forward candy profiles reminiscent of Zkittlez with the pungent, fuel-like funk associated with strains like GMO. The result is a complex and highly sought-after strain prized not just for its memorable name, but for its dense resin production, layered aromatic bouquet, and a robust, multifaceted effect profile. High Fructose Corn Syrup sits squarely within the new wave of hybrids designed to deliver both substantial potency and an unforgettable sensory experience, making it a favorite among seasoned consumers looking for depth beyond simple THC percentages.
Visually, High Fructose Corn Syrup is a treat for the eyes, often presenting as a frosty, trichome-encrusted spectacle. The buds are typically dense and chunky, adhering to the modern structure of high-yielding, resinous cultivars. They display a vibrant color palette of deep forest greens, often interwoven with striking purple hues that emerge under cooler nighttime temperatures during cultivation. A thick blanket of milky-white and amber trichomes gives the buds a sugary, crystalline appearance that lives up to its sweet namesake. Orange and rust-colored pistils weave through the foliage, adding to its visual complexity. For growers, High Fructose Corn Syrup is considered a moderately challenging strain that rewards patience and care with impressive yields. It has a flowering time of approximately 8-10 weeks and thrives in controlled environments where its dense bud structure can be monitored to prevent moisture-related issues.
The aroma and flavor profile of High Fructose Corn Syrup is where it truly earns its distinctive name. The initial scent is an overwhelming wave of sugary sweetness, evoking memories of candy stores, ripe tropical fruit baskets, and dessert counters. Notes of juicy mango, tangy citrus, and mixed berries dominate the forefront. As you delve deeper, a contrasting layer of sharp, gassy diesel and earthy funk emerges, providing a sophisticated counterbalance that prevents the sweetness from becoming cloying. This complex bouquet is a direct result of its rich terpene profile. Upon inhalation, the flavor translates beautifully, with the sweet and fruity notes hitting the palate first—think grape soda, vanilla cream, and tropical punch—followed by a spicy, peppery exhale with a lingering diesel aftertaste. The experience is remarkably true to its aromatic promise.
The effects of High Fructose Corn Syrup are as layered as its flavor, offering a journey that begins cerebrally before settling into the body. Users typically report an initial surge of euphoria and mental uplift. This cerebral onset promotes a happy, creative, and sociable mindset, making thoughts flow more freely and conversation sparkle. This buoyant, euphoric headspace is the hallmark of the High Fructose Corn Syrup experience. As the high progresses, a profound sense of physical relaxation gently washes over the body without leading to heavy sedation or couch-lock for most users. This dual-action effect makes it exceptionally versatile. The overall sensation is one of calm contentment—mentally elevated yet physically at ease. It's this balance that makes the High Fructose Corn Syrup strain so appealing for a wide range of activities and times of day.
Medically, the High Fructose Corn Syrup strain's effect profile suggests several potential therapeutic applications. Its potent mood-elevating and euphoric properties can provide temporary relief from symptoms of stress, anxiety, and depression by promoting a positive mental state. The significant physical relaxation that follows the cerebral onset may help alleviate mild to moderate aches, pains, and muscle tension. Furthermore, the strain's notable side effect of inducing hunger (often referred to as 'the munchies') can be beneficial for individuals struggling with appetite loss due to medical conditions or treatments like chemotherapy. Patients seeking relief from chronic fatigue or low mood may also find the initial uplifting effects of High Fructose Corn Syrup beneficial. However, it is always crucial to consult with a healthcare professional before using cannabis for medical purposes.
To fully enjoy the High Fructose Corn Syrup experience, consumption method and timing are key. For flavor connoisseurs, vaporizing at a low to medium temperature is ideal, as it preserves the delicate spectrum of sweet and diesel terpenes. Smoking in a clean glass piece also delivers the full, robust flavor profile. Given its hybrid nature and balanced effects, High Fructose Corn Syrup is remarkably versatile regarding timing. It can be an excellent choice for a late afternoon session, helping to melt away the day's stress while maintaining enough mental clarity for social interaction or creative pursuits. It can also transition seamlessly into the evening, providing deep relaxation perfect for unwinding, enjoying a meal, or watching a movie. Due to its potency, novice consumers should start with a low dose and pace themselves.
